Hair

Eyelashes and hair can give your doll an authentic appearance. You can choose to use synthetic hair, fabric hair or yarn for your dolls. Synthetic hair is typically used on knitted and fabric dolls, and is available at most craft stores. Also, yarn hair is often used to make these types of dolls and is purchased from the majority of yarn stores. You can pick the length of hair you want for your doll based on its character. If you're creating a Rapunzel doll, for instance you'll want your doll to have long hair.

Mohair is a popular option because it looks and feels more like real hair. It's more difficult to get mohair hair strands into a doll's head than other materials.

Weight

The size of a doll may influence how realistic it appears and how easy it is to handle. Some collectors favor tiny and delicate newborn dolls, while others prefer bigger toddlers.

Vinyl is used to make the most realistic dolls. It's more durable and stronger than silicone, and is also easy to clean. The addition of weights can make them more realistic and comfortable to hold.

Many makers include a "chestplate" (often called as a bellybutton) to the vinyl body in order to make it feel more lifelike. This adds a little extra to the size of the chest which can help with clothing fit and creates a space for the maker to stuff the arms, head, and other components. It is important to only lightly fill these areas, to ensure that the doll does not appear stiff or heavy. Many reborn doll makers put off this process until later, once the arms and other parts have been attached.
